Clothing and Personal Items
When it comes to packing your clothing and personal items for a cross-country move, it’s crucial to consider the climate of your destination and any potential weather-related challenges along the way. Packing a variety of clothing options, including seasonal items like coats, hats, and gloves, will ensure you’re prepared for any weather conditions you might encounter. Don’t forget essentials like underwear, pajamas, and towels for the first week after the move. Toiletries and Hygiene Products
Packing toiletries and hygiene products should be approached with care, as spills and leaks can cause damage to other items in your moving boxes. To prevent any accidents, it’s advisable to pack these items in leak-proof containers or plastic bags, even if you have just a few items to transport.

Important Documents and Identification
When moving across the country, it’s crucial to keep important documents and identification safe and easily accessible. Items such as passports, driver’s licenses, birth certificates, and property documents should be packed separately from your other belongings, ensuring that they are readily available when needed. You may also want to create a moving file for personal use, containing documents such as your driver’s license, voter registration, school records, pet-related documentation, and mail-forwarding information.
In addition to personal identification, don’t forget to pack valuable items such as jewelry and family heirlooms, along with all your belongings. These items should be carefully wrapped and secured, either in a separate box or in a container that can be kept with you during the move. By keeping these important items close at hand, you can ensure their safety and have peace of mind as you embark on your cross-country journey.

Understanding Insurance Options
Insurance coverage is an important aspect of any long-distance move. Most moving companies offer insurance options such as released value coverage, full value protection, and third-party insurance. The cost of insurance coverage may vary based on the type of coverage selected and the value of your belongings.
Be sure to read the fine print of the insurance policy to understand what is included and what is not, and consider additional coverage if necessary to protect your valuable items during the move.

Renting a Moving Truck
Renting a moving truck is a popular DIY moving option, providing you with the flexibility to pack and transport your belongings at your own pace. When selecting a truck, consider factors such as size, fuel efficiency, and cost. Make sure to inspect the vehicle for any signs of damage or mechanical issues before renting.
Once you finally have the right truck, load your belongings efficiently and securely, paying special attention to the distribution of weight and the placement of fragile items. Drive safely during your long-distance move, taking breaks as needed to rest and refuel.
Using Portable Containers
Portable containers provide a convenient and flexible option for a DIY cross-country move. These containers are available in various sizes and can be delivered to your home, allowing you to pack at your leisure. Once you’ve packed the container, the company will transport it to your new home, where you can unload and unpack at your own pace.
When selecting a portable container company for purchase, consider factors such as convenience, security, size options, cost, and customer reviews.

Fragile Objects
When it comes to packing fragile objects like glassware, ceramics, and electronics, proper packing is crucial to prevent damage during transit. Wrap each item in bubble wrap and secure it with duct tape, ensuring that each object is packed separately to avoid contact.
Avoid overpacking boxes, and place heavier items at the bottom with lighter items on top. Fill any empty spaces in the boxes with packing peanuts or shredded paper to prevent movement during transit.

Large Appliances
Preparing and packing large appliances, such as refrigerators and washing machines, for a cross-country move can be a daunting task. Here are some steps to follow.
-
Start by cleaning and drying the appliances to prevent mold or mildew during the move.
-
Disconnect and drain any hoses or water connections.
-
Leave the appliance doors open for a few days to air out.
Use sturdy boxes and packing materials to protect the appliances, and label boxes with the name of the appliance and the destination room. If you’re unsure about how to pack your large appliances, consider hiring professional packing services to ensure that they are properly prepared for the move.

Pet Travel Tips
Keeping your pets comfortable and safe during a cross-country move requires proper planning and preparation. Here are some tips to help you:
-
Consider booking a direct flight or driving in a car to reduce stress for your pet.
-
Bring along familiar items like toys, bedding, and food.
-
Provide frequent breaks throughout the journey for rest and exercise.
Make sure to have the necessary documentation for pet travel, such as proof of vaccinations, a health certificate, and a pet passport. By taking these precautions, you can ensure that your pet’s first night in their new home is as stress-free and comfortable as possible.
Plant Packing and Transportation
Packing and transporting plants during a cross-country move requires careful planning and temperature regulation. Use appropriate packing materials and containers to protect your plants from extreme temperatures, and be aware of any restrictions on transporting plants across state lines. Research local laws and regulations, as well as airline and shipping restrictions, before packing and transporting your plants to ensure compliance.
With proper care and attention, your plants can arrive at your new home healthy and ready to thrive.
